The Foundation: Comprehensive Keyword Research for On-Page Optimization

At the heart of any successful on-page SEO package is meticulous keyword research. This isn’t just about finding popular words; it’s about understanding the language your potential customers use when searching for your products or services. Effective advanced keyword research techniques form the bedrock upon which all other on-page efforts are built, ensuring that your content resonates with both users and search engine algorithms.

Identifying High-Value Keywords

A professional on-page SEO service begins by delving deep into your industry, target audience, and business goals to identify a strategic set of keywords. This includes:

  • Short-Tail Keywords: Broad terms with high search volume (e.g., “digital marketing”).
  • Long-Tail Keywords: More specific phrases with lower volume but higher intent (e.g., “affordable digital marketing services for small businesses”).
  • LSI (Latent Semantic Indexing) Keywords: Related terms that provide context and semantic richness to your content, helping search engines understand your topic more deeply.

The goal is to find a balance between search volume, competition, and relevance to your offerings. This strategic selection ensures that the keywords chosen for your website content optimization efforts are not just popular, but also highly convertible.

Competitor Keyword Analysis

Part of a robust keyword research for on-page strategy involves analyzing what your competitors are ranking for. This provides valuable insights into:

  • Keywords they might be overlooking.
  • Keywords that are driving significant traffic to their sites.
  • Content gaps where you can create more comprehensive or authoritative content.

By understanding your competitive landscape, an on-page SEO package can help you carve out your unique space in search results, focusing on areas where you can genuinely outrank your rivals.

Crafting Engaging Headings and Subheadings

Your headings (H2s, H3s, H4s) serve multiple purposes: they break up text, improve readability, and signal to search engines the main topics and subtopics of your page. An on-page SEO package will ensure your headings are:

  • Clear and descriptive.
  • Contain relevant keywords where appropriate.
  • Logically structured to guide the reader through the content.

Strategic Keyword Placement and Density

While keyword stuffing is a relic of the past, strategic keyword placement remains vital. This means naturally integrating your primary and secondary keywords into your content, particularly in the introduction, body paragraphs, and conclusion. The focus is always on readability and user value, ensuring keywords enhance the text rather than detract from it.

Meta Title and Description Optimization

Your meta title and description are critical for click-through rates (CTR) from search results. A professional on-page SEO package will optimize these elements to be:

  • Unique and compelling.
  • Within character limits.
  • Include primary keywords.
  • Accurately summarize the page’s content.

Mastering the art of crafting compelling meta descriptions can significantly impact how many users choose your link over a competitor’s.

Image Optimization (Alt Text, File Names)

Images are not just for visual appeal; they can also contribute to your SEO. Optimization includes:

  • Using descriptive file names.
  • Writing keyword-rich alt text for accessibility and search engine understanding.
  • Compressing images for faster load times.

URL Structure Optimization

Clean, descriptive URLs help both users and search engines understand what a page is about. An on-page SEO service will ensure your URLs are:

  • Short and concise.
  • Keyword-rich.
  • Easy to read and understand.
  • Use hyphens to separate words.

Internal Linking Strategy

Internal links connect different pages within your website, helping search engines discover new content and pass “link juice” (ranking power) between pages. A strategic internal linking structure improves user navigation and reinforces the topical authority of your content.

Schema Markup Implementation

Schema markup (or structured data) is a powerful tool that helps search engines understand the context of your content. Implementing structured data for better visibility can lead to rich snippets in search results, such as star ratings, product prices, or event dates, making your listings more appealing and informative.

Page Speed Enhancements

Page load speed is a critical ranking factor and a significant contributor to user experience. An on-page SEO package will often include recommendations or direct implementation for improving your site’s speed through:

  • Image compression.
  • Browser caching.
  • Minifying CSS and JavaScript files.
  • Leveraging content delivery networks (CDNs).

Optimizing for core web vitals is crucial for both user experience and search engine rankings.

Mobile-Friendliness

With the majority of internet users browsing on mobile devices, having a responsive and mobile-friendly website is no longer optional. An on-page SEO service will ensure your site offers a seamless experience across all devices.

What Happens During a Technical SEO Audit?

A core component of any comprehensive on-page SEO package is a thorough technical SEO audit. This isn’t just a checklist; it’s a deep dive into the underlying health of your website, identifying issues that could be hindering your search engine performance. Think of it as a diagnostic check-up for your website’s search engine visibility.

During a technical SEO audit, experts will scrutinize various aspects of your site, including:

  • Crawlability and Indexability: Ensuring search engine bots can easily access and understand all relevant pages on your site. This involves checking robots.txt files, meta robot tags, and XML sitemaps.
  • Broken Links and Redirects: Identifying and fixing broken internal and external links, as well as ensuring proper 301 redirects are in place to preserve link equity and user experience.
  • Duplicate Content Issues: Detecting instances where identical or near-identical content exists on multiple URLs, which can confuse search engines and dilute ranking power. Solutions often involve canonical tags.
  • Site Architecture: Evaluating the logical structure of your website to ensure content is organized intuitively for both users and search engines. A flat, well-linked architecture is often preferred.
  • HTTPS Status: Verifying that your site uses a secure HTTPS connection, which is a ranking signal and crucial for user trust.
  • Canonicalization: Implementing canonical tags to tell search engines which version of a page is the preferred one, especially when dealing with similar content.
  • XML Sitemaps: Ensuring your XML sitemap is up-to-date, correctly formatted, and submitted to search engines to help them discover all your important pages.

The insights gained from a comprehensive SEO audit are then used to create an actionable plan, addressing critical issues that could be preventing your website from reaching its full potential in search rankings.

Content Gap Analysis

A content gap analysis identifies topics or keywords that your competitors are ranking for but your website currently isn’t addressing. This allows for the creation of new, valuable content that can attract a previously untapped audience and establish your site as a comprehensive resource in your niche.

User Experience (UX) Enhancements

Search engines increasingly prioritize user experience. A high-quality on-page SEO package will not only focus on technical and content aspects but also recommend improvements to your site’s UX, such as:

  • Improved navigation and site layout.
  • Enhanced readability through formatting and visual elements.
  • Clear calls to action (CTAs).

A good user experience leads to lower bounce rates and higher engagement, which are positive signals for search engines.

Ongoing Monitoring and Reporting

SEO is not a one-time task; it’s an ongoing process. A reputable on-page SEO package will typically include regular monitoring of your website’s performance, tracking keyword rankings, organic traffic, and other key metrics. Detailed reports will keep you informed about progress, identify new opportunities, and allow for continuous refinement of the strategy.
